§ 23-81-105. Life insurance -- Incontestability provision

AR Code ยง 23-81-105 (2016) What's This?

There shall be a provision that, except for fraud in the procurement, the policy, exclusive of provisions relating to disability benefits or to additional benefits in the event of death by accident or accidental means, shall be incontestable, except for nonpayment of premiums, after it has been in force during the lifetime of the insured for a period of two (2) years from its date of issue. However, at its option, the insurer may omit from the provision the phrase "except for fraud in the procurement".
